congrats on the purchase. search the forums and you will find many of your answers. to service the vehicle, the front end (bumper, condensor, radiator, support etc...) has to be pulled apart, also called "service mode". The turbos are of the K03 variety, a pair of the same ones that the 1.8T's have. Because it is forced induction, yes, it is TWIN intercooled, theyre on the sides of the engine up front. turbo upgrade - KO4, but any turbo upgrade is alot of $$ since you have to pull the motor to access the turbos, IMO not worth it for now.

IC's - go with some rs4 intercoolers

strut bars - none exist

CAI - debated topic, some say it helps some dont. eitherway it makes the car sound alot better

BOV - it will make you CEL come on, so dont bother. get a nice DV like a forge or something

lowering springs - anything is good really, jut make sure you replace the struts with something better than stock that can handle the drop. Eibach and H&R have some nice cup kits
